TEMPO CHANGE (RITARD and ACCELER)
The ACCELER/RITARD parameter allows you to speed 
up or slow down the Style tempo by the amount you 
set here. To use these functions, you must assign 
them to the ASSIGN SW buttons or an optional FC-7.
There are three Ritardando functions: one for all 
Style patterns, one for Ending patterns and one for 
Fill-Ins. They all use the TEMPO CHANGE settings on 
the following page.

● ACCELER/RITARD—Allows you to set the degree (ratio)
by which the tempo changes when the ACCELER or 
RITARD function is triggered. Example: if the tempo is 
currently 
q= 100, the value “20%” means that the
tempo drops to
q= 80 or rises to q= 120.

● CPT (15~3825)—Use this parameter to specify how long
a Ritardando/Accelerando should take. In most cases, 
480 CPT (i.e. one measure) is probably the most musical 
choice.
■Using the Ritardando/Accelerando functions
(4) For general applications (any Style division) pro-
ceed as follows:
• Assign the RITARD and/or ACCELER function.
• Press the [START÷STOP] button to start Style play-
back.
• Press the assigned button or footswitch. By assigning
two controls, you can increase (ACC) and decrease 
(RIT) the tempo.
(5) For Ritardandos that apply to Ending patterns pro-
ceed as follows:
• Press the [START÷STOP] button to start Style play-
back.
• Press the [END/RIT] button twice in succession (“dou-
ble-click”).
This selects an Ending pattern and slows down the 
tempo according to the ACCELER/RITARD and CPT 
settings. When the Ending phrase is finished (and 
Arranger playback stops), the tempo is reset.
(6) For Fill Ritardando:
The FILL RIT function is suitable for ballads. It causes 
the next Fill-In to slow down (“ritardando”).
